“Animal Armies Part Two”

Jeff Lemire's unsettling vision gets a brilliantly strange cover treatment here: a set of Russian nesting dolls, each one containing a different hybrid child — a pig-nosed figure, a smaller alien-eared one, and a tiny animal-faced creature — while the largest doll has been cracked open to reveal a wide-eyed adult man in a flannel shirt, staring out with an almost haunted expression. The nesting-doll metaphor feels perfectly chosen for a series about children who don't fit the world they've inherited. This December 2010 Vertigo issue, part two of the "Animal Armies" arc, showcases why Sweet Tooth earned its devoted readership.
